This field displays the gateway IP address for the routers
local area network (LAN). This IP address is the same as
you use to login to the Bright Box admin pages, and is
'192.168.1.1' by default.
The value can be configured on the Advanced Set-Up >
DHCP page.
This field displays the subnet mask for the routers local
area network (LAN). The value of this field is
'255.255.255.0' by default.
The value can be configured on the Advanced Set-Up >
DHCP page.
This field displays the status of the router's Dynamic Host
Control Protocol (DHCP). The value is 'Enabled' by default,
meaning that LAN IP addresses are automatically
allocated to client devices connecting to the router. If the
value is 'Disabled' then client devices must supply their
own LAN IP addresses in order to connect to the router.
The setting can be configured on the Advanced Set-Up
> DHCP page.
